3.4.1 Displaying Height
Tessellation shaders allow for adaptive subdivision of the surface geometry by
introducing two new shader stages after the vertex shader: a hull and a domain
shader. The hull shader is typically used to perform calculations for each control
point of a surface patch. In our case, both the vertex and hull shader by-pass po-
sitions, normals, and texture coordinates. The function
ConstantHS in Listing 3.9
is executed once per control patch to compute the distance-dependent tessellation
factors. Based on these factors, a fixed-function tessellation engine subdivides the
